Engine Management
 
I am getting ready to build VQ37 motor... Wanted to know what engine management systems you guys are using and weather or not you can keep the Synchrorev match and/or is it worth keeping with a twin turbo setup?

bullitt5897 11-12-2011 05:34 PM

If you get the GTM TT kits you ECU will be reflashed for the turbos. Other than that you can spend some extra money to get the HKS F-Con Vpro. You will run about $4k+ going standalone (HKS F-Con or more) I am the only owner one so far to push our platform to the limits. GTM is a top notch manufacturer and you cant go wrong with their kits.

All in all, Your ECU will get reflashed and you keep syncro rev match which is AWESOME!!!

MattP725 11-12-2011 08:51 PM

UpRev seems to handle most boost applications... no need to go stand alone at moderate levels.
